CODE ENFORCEMENT INSPECTOR

Part Time

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S: An employee in this class may be called upon to do any or all of the following: (These examples do not include all of the tasks which the employee may be expected to perform).

  • Inspect rental dwellings to insure compliance with the Municipal Code , the Zoning Ordinance and International Property Maintenance Codes; send out notifications of deficiencies and gain compliance.
  • Inspect all properties including exterior property areas for compliance of the Municipal Code , the Zoning Ordinance and International Property Maintenance Codes while in the field and take necessary action to gain compliance.
  • Advise owners, occupants and contractors of the applicable codes, ordinances and regulations they must follow to gain compliance.
  • Prepare and maintain detailed records of inspections, complaints and investigations and prepare reports as directed.
  • Gather and prepare evidence related to dangerous buildings, attend and testify at Hearing Officer Case and Board of Appeals.
  • Testify in court proceedings to gain compliance in the enforcement of the Municipal Code , the Zoning Ordinance and International Property Maintenance Code as adopted by the City of Pontiac.
  • Perform related work as assigned.
  • Perform data entry
  • Post stop works orders on un-permitted or unauthorized work.

Requirements

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S FOR EMPLOYMENT:

  • Considerable knowledge of the laws, ordinances, and codes dealing with; the Municipal Code , the Zoning Ordinance and International Property Maintenance Code Municipal Code.
  • Considerable knowledge of inspection methods, practices and techniques pertaining to any and all structures and exterior property areas.
  • Ability to read and interpret plans specifications and blueprints.
  • Ability to detect differences and other faults and to appraise the quality of workmanship.
  • Ability to prepare, maintain, accurate and comprehensive written records.
  • Ability to respond to citizen’s inquiries and complaints in a manner, which results in a satisfactory resolution of, said inquiries and complaints.
  • Ability to learn, understand and explain to the public the Municipal Code, Zoning ordinances and the international Property Maintenance Codes.
  • Ability to walk and stand for long periods of time on a daily basis, to climb stairs in buildings inspected, to drive to and from inspection sites, and to work outside in inclement weather and in areas exposed to dust, dirt and pollen.
  • Ability to operate the Microsoft office suite of products
  • Ability to perform data entry and follow set processes
  • Ability to understand and carry out complex oral and written instructions.

A CODE ENFORCEMENT OFFICER SHALL HAVE THE FOLLOWING TRAINING AND EXPERIENCE:

  • Graduation from an accredited high school, supplemented by at least (2-5) years of practical work experience or equivalent involving public contacts in Code Enforcement, Zoning Enforcement and/or Rental Inspections.
  • Licenses: A valid State of Michigan vehicle operator’s license and a satisfactory driving record.
